Tragic Loss: Davie Beauty Student Aileen Martinez Remembered as Talented Artist After Fatal Parking Lot Shooting

Davie, Florida — A shooting at a local beauty school this week has claimed the life of a 20-year-old student, identified by friends as Aileen Martinez. A student at the Aveda Institute, Martinez was described as passionate about cosmetology and had dreams of one day opening her own salon.

According to authorities, the tragic incident occurred in the school’s parking lot when Martinez was allegedly shot by her ex-boyfriend on Tuesday. The suspect, a 25-year-old man, reportedly took his own life after the confrontation. He was later transported to a hospital where he succumbed to his injuries.

Rachel Tracey, a close friend of Martinez, expressed her grief and disbelief over the sudden loss. “She was full of life and had so many dreams,” Tracey said, emphasizing Martinez’s vibrant personality and her enthusiasm for rock music. Friends noted that she often performed at various events across Florida, showcasing her talent and creativity.

The reasons behind the shooting remain unclear, and law enforcement continues to investigate the circumstances surrounding the tragic events. Meanwhile, Martinez’s family has initiated a GoFundMe campaign to assist with funeral costs, highlighting the emotional impact of this devastating loss.

“This is a heartbreaking situation for our community,” a local resident remarked, reflecting the shock felt by many who knew the young student. The Aveda Institute community is also grappling with the loss, mourning the promising future of a student taken too soon.

Support services have been made available for students and others affected by the incident, as the school seeks to provide a safe and supportive environment during this difficult time. As authorities work to piece together the details of the case, the legacy of Aileen Martinez—a passionate student and aspiring salon owner—remains in the hearts of those she touched.
